Pasco Sheriff: Gulf Highlands Elementary Briefly On Controlled Campus, No Threat Found

PASCO COUNTY, Fla.- Pasco Sheriff’s Office reported that Gulf Highlands Elementary School was temporarily placed on controlled campus status as deputies investigated a student’s claim of bringing a firearm to school.

The student in question was located, and no weapon was found.

The Sheriff’s Office confirmed that this was an isolated incident and there was no ongoing threat to the school. Gulf Highlands Elementary has returned to its normal operations.
